About Alcoholic beverage, beer, light

Light beer is regular beer brewed to finish with fewer calories and usually a little less alcohol, typically landing around 4.2% alcohol by volume. Brewers get there by fermenting more of the grain sugars or by simply using less malt, which leaves a thinner, crisper, less filling drink — the trade-off most light lagers make in exchange for that lower calorie count.

Per 100 grams light beer provides about 29 calories, almost no fat, around 1.6 grams of carbohydrate and roughly 3.1 grams of alcohol, with only traces of protein and minerals. People drink it by the can, though: a 12-ounce serving (about 355 grams) comes to roughly 100 calories, close to 11 grams of alcohol and under 6 grams of carbohydrate — about 30 calories less than a same-size regular beer, with most of the savings coming from the slightly lower alcohol.

The calories in any beer come mostly from alcohol rather than sugar, which is why "light" mainly means "a bit less alcohol and a bit less malt." It is genuinely lighter than standard beer, but it is still an alcoholic drink: a 12-ounce light beer is one standard drink, and the usual guidance about drinking in moderation — and not at all during pregnancy — still applies.
